Hi All, I am very New to SEO... Please guide me.... I want to know the number of characters which should be used in Title tag..
Google will show only 60 to 70 characters only in Google SERP (Seach engine result pages). So it is always better to include characters below 70.
Hello Dear, There should be 60 to 65 characters for google and 65 to 75 characters for yahoo including space n all symbols.
Usually I have seen in many occasions Google displayed only 50 - 60 characters max so better to be in that limit.
We did a lot of testing with this when we built one of our sites and found the maximum title length that would fully display in Google was 67.

Normally, Google shows 60-70 chars in the title. The main question is how many chars Google takes into account for ranking? There are different guestimates, from first 50 till first 120. Another question is how the ranking influence of each word is dropping with the position in the title. I believe, the dependency is not linear. Like, the words within the first 50-70 chars have very similar influence, than there is a drop for the words in the next 50 chars or so, and the remaining words are not taken into account for ranking, imho.
